Greer Mill project moving forward
The Greer Board of Architectural Review (BAR) has unanimously (4-0) recommended a Local Historic Designation for the Greer Mill, which is in the process of being redeveloped for residential and commercial use.

Wellford officials are working with community members to initiate clean-up efforts around the city.
The first public meeting on the issue took place on Monday at Wellford City Hall.
Wellford Police Chief David Green spoke at the event, emphasizing the slogan “clean communities are safe communities.”

South Carolina Ports had its best calendar year in 2021.
“(It was) truly a banner year for South Carolina Ports,” said SC Ports CEO Jim Newsome. “Amid tremendous and ongoing supply chain challenges, we handled record-breaking cargo volumes, while consistently providing capacity and fluidity for our customers.”
South Carolina Governor Henry McMaster has reappointed Valerie J. Miller and Doug Smith to the Greenville-Spartanburg Airport Commission.
The term for both Commissioners runs from December 31, 2021, through December 31, 2027.

Duncan PD sets up
donation trailer
The Duncan Police Department has set up a trailer at the Duncan Event Center, located at 121 S. Spencer Street, Duncan, to collect aluminum cans donated by the community.
All money collected from the cans will go to the Burned Children’s Foundation at MUSC.
The Volunteer Income Tax Assistance (VITA) program offers free tax help to those who meet the income criteria.
IRS-certified volunteers provide free basic income tax return preparation with electronic filing to qualified individuals.
